How Surge Protectors Save Your HVAC System
Power surges come in two forms. External surges hit your home from outside sources like lightning strikes or utility grid switching. Internal surges happen when your own appliances turn on and off cycling power through your home’s electrical system. Both types can damage your AC. External surges are the most destructive. A lightning strike miles away can send a 20,000-volt spike through power lines. That spike travels at nearly the speed of light. By the time you hear the thunder your AC’s electronics are already fried. Whole-home surge protectors installed at your main electrical panel stop these spikes before they enter your home’s wiring.
Internal surges are smaller but more frequent. Every time your refrigerator compressor starts or your washing machine kicks on it creates a tiny power spike. These mini-surges don’t destroy your AC immediately but they wear down components over time. Point-of-use surge protectors at your AC disconnect box provide an extra layer of defense against these constant small hits.

Frequently Asked Questions
How much does AC surge protection cost in Riverside?
Whole-home surge protectors range from $200 to $500 for the device plus installation. Point-of-use protectors at the AC disconnect cost $150 to $300 installed. Most homeowners spend $300 to $600 total for complete protection. How Much Does a New AC Installation Cost in Woodcrest Today?.
Will surge protection affect my AC warranty?
Most major AC manufacturers require surge protection to keep warranties valid. Carrier, Lennox, and Trane all specify surge protection in their warranty terms. Installing protection actually helps you maintain warranty coverage if a power surge damages your system.
How long do surge protectors last?
Quality surge protectors last 5 to 10 years under normal conditions. In Riverside’s high-heat environment with frequent grid fluctuations you might need replacement every 3 to 5 years. Most units have status lights that indicate when protection components need replacement.
Can I install surge protection myself?
Whole-home surge protectors require working inside your main electrical panel. This work involves high voltage and must comply with California Electrical Code. Only licensed electricians should perform this installation. DIY installation voids warranties and creates safety hazards.
What’s the difference between whole-home and point-of-use protection?
Whole-home protectors mount at your main electrical panel and protect all circuits in your home. Point-of-use protectors mount near specific appliances like your AC disconnect box. Whole-home protection stops external surges. Point-of-use protection handles internal surges and provides backup if the main protector fails.

Technical Specifications for Modern AC Systems
Today’s high-efficiency AC units have sensitive electronics that older systems never had. Inverter-driven compressors use variable-speed motors controlled by sophisticated circuit boards. These boards contain microprocessors that cost $500 to $1,000 alone.
Modern AC units operate at tighter voltage tolerances than ever before. While older units could handle 10% voltage variations new systems need stable power within 5% of nominal voltage. That’s why they’re more vulnerable to grid fluctuations.
The control boards in 2026 AC models include features like Wi-Fi connectivity, smart thermostats, and variable-speed fan controls. Each feature adds another point of failure during a power surge. Whole-home protection shields all these sensitive components at once.

Maintenance and Monitoring
Surge protectors require minimal maintenance but periodic checks ensure they’re working properly. Most units have LED indicators that show protection status. A green light means normal operation. A red or flashing light indicates the protection components need replacement.
We recommend annual inspections of your surge protection system. During these checks we verify all connections are tight and the status indicators show proper operation. We also test your AC system to ensure no voltage irregularities exist.

Future-Proofing Your Investment
Technology continues advancing rapidly. Smart home integration, higher efficiency standards, and renewable energy systems all affect how we protect AC equipment. Modern surge protectors accommodate these changes.
Solar panel systems create unique power quality issues. The DC to AC conversion process can introduce harmonics and voltage irregularities. Surge protection must account for these renewable energy sources.
Electric vehicle charging stations add another load to your home’s electrical system. These high-power devices can create internal surges affecting your AC. Integrated protection systems handle multiple modern electrical loads.
